Cheapest Available Scioto Reserve North Apartments for Rent

 

The cheapest available apartment rental in the Scioto Reserve North area of Columbus, OH is a 1 Bed unit found at The Residences at Golf Village priced from $1,200. Rosewood Village has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 1 Bed apartment currently listed from $1,245. Here are the most affordable Scioto Reserve North apartments for rent in Columbus, OH:

Apartment ListingModel NameBed/BathPriced From
The Residences at Golf VillageThe Alum1BR,1BA$1,200
Rosewood VillageTHE BERLIN1BR,1BA$1,245
Cortland PowellPrime 21BR,1BA$1,346

Best Value Apartments for Rent in Scioto Reserve North, OH

As of January 11, 2026 the best value apartment in the Scioto Reserve North area is the $1.34 price per square foot 3-Bedroom Townhome Model at Liberty Reserve in the in the Scioto Reserve North neighborhood starting from $2,984. The second greatest value Scioto Reserve North apartment is the Edgewater 3 Model at The Residences at Sara Crossing starting at $2,494 with a $1.80 price per square foot in the Scioto Reserve North neighborhood. Here is today’s list of the best values for Scioto Reserve North apartments based on price per square foot:

Apartment ListingModel NameBed/BathPrice Per Sq.Ft.
Liberty Reserve3-Bedroom Townhome3BR,2.5BA$1.34
The Residences at Sara CrossingEdgewater 32BR,2BA$1.80
Liberty Grand CommunitiesMajestic2BR,2BA$1.84
Redwood PowellMeadowood2BR,2BA$1.83
Liberty SummitArbor1BR,1BA$1.60
Bear PointeTwo Bedroom, One Bath2BR,1BA$1.77
Rosewood VillageTHE BERLIN1BR,1BA$1.51
Cortland PowellPrime 21BR,1BA$1.73
Nolan ReserveTHE SCIOTO1BR,1BA$1.96
The Residences at Golf VillageThe Alum1BR,1BA$1.76
